  • Patent number: 11155468
    Abstract: Process for the synthesis of ammonia comprising the steps of reforming of a hydrocarbon feedstock into a raw product gas, purification of said raw product gas obtaining a make-up synthesis gas, conversion of said synthesis gas into ammonia; said purification includes shift conversion of carbon monoxide into carbon dioxide and the reforming process requires a heat input which is at least partially recovered from at least one of said step of shift conversion, which is carried out with a peak temperature of at least 450° C., and said step of conversion into ammonia.

  • Publication number: 20210261425
    Abstract: A process for the synthesis of ammonia from a hydrocarbon feedstock, wherein the process includes reforming the hydrocarbon feedstock to produce a make-up gas and converting said make-up gas into ammonia, the process is performed in an ammonia synthesis plant requiring an electric power for operation and also requiring a start-up power (Ps) for start-up, wherein a first electric power (P1) is internally produced in the ammonia plant, and a second electric power (P2) is imported, wherein said second electric power is equal to or greater than said start-up power (Ps).

  • Patent number: 4934819
    Abstract: The value of a transverse moment of any order of the electromagnetic field associated with an optical beam (and in particular the spot-size of such a beam) is determined by two successive measurements of the optical power of the beam: one measurement is a direct measurement, the other is effected after spatially modulating the transverse distribution of the electromagnetic field by a factor proportional to the n-th power of the transverse coordinate of the beam, n being the moment order. The moment can be obtained from the ratio between the two measurements. The invention includes also the apparatus for carrying out the method.

  • Patent number: 3967205
    Abstract: In order to convert a basic frequency by an odd integer K = 2n.+-.1, a square wave of that basic frequency is fed alternately over a noninverting and an inverting branch of a switching circuit to a pulse counter working into a decoder which emits a resetting pulse for the counter on every n.sup.th cycle. A flip-flop alternately set and reset by successive setting pulses feeds back a control signal to the switching circuit for a periodic reversal of the polarity of the incoming square wave either in the middle of the n.sup.th cycle, for K = 2n-1, or after a half-cycle delay from the end of the n.sup.th cycle, for K = 2n+1.

  • Patent number: 3961277
    Abstract: To demodulate an incoming oscillation consisting of a succession of distinct signal frequencies, particularly in a data-transmission system using an alternation of two keying frequencies, the incoming oscillation is squared and then passed through a differentiator deriving a pair of closely spaced trigger pulses from any zero crossing of the incoming oscillation. The first trigger pulse causes the transfer of the contents of a buffer register, receiving the reading of a pulse counter, into a digital/analog converter whose output is compared with a reference voltage in a threshold circuit; the second trigger pulse resets the counter which receives locally generated clock pulses whose cadence is high compared to the signal frequencies.
